The Lancaster Canal
"The Lancaster Canal is a canal in the north of England, originally planned to run from Westhoughton in Lancashire to Kendal in south Cumbria (then in Westmorland). The section around the crossing of the River Ribble was never completed, and much of the southern end leased to the Leeds and Liverpool Canal, of which it is now generally considered part.

Of the canal north of Preston, only the section from Preston to Tewitfield near Carnforth in Lancashire is currently open to navigation for 42 miles (67.6 km).

The milestone
The canal is one of the most rural in the UK and passes through only a few large towns. The milestones on the canal therefore only show distances to the nearest large town, rather than the end points on the canal.

This milestone is on the un-navigable section of the canal, north of Tewitfield. Although no boats pass along the canal the towpath is still maintained and popular with walkers and cyclists.

The milestones on this section show the distances between Lancaster, and the original northern end at Kendal, even though the navigable northern end is now Tewitfield.

From Stainton northwards the canal has been filled in and the route of the old towpath still maintained as a footpath even though in some sections there is no sign at all that a canal ever existed.

This milestone stands alone in a farmers field, the only clue to the former canal being a nearby canal bridge that still stands even though there is no canal to cross.

The milestone has been pained white and the distances painted black and is probably the smartest looking milestone on the whole route of the canal.
